Manual page for ENABLENUMLOCK(1)

enablenumlock, disablenumlock - enable or disable the numlock key

SYNOPSIS

enablenumlock

disablenumlock

AVAILABILITY

Available only on Sun 386i systems running a SunOS 4.0.x release or earlier. Not a SunOS 4.1 release feature.

DESCRIPTION

When you press the ``Num Lock'' key and then press one of the keys numbered R1 through R15 on the right keypad, the character on the upper part of the key is generated rather than the key's function.

In previous releases, ``Num Lock'' was enabled only in DOS windows and in some third-party UNIX applications. Currently, ``Num Lock'' is enabled by default for the right keypad in all SunView windows.

enablenumlock re-enables ``Num Lock'' for applications that expect it to be enabled.

BUGS

The default enabling of the ``Num Lock'' key is incompatible with some applications with special work around code to enable the ``Num Lock'' key. These applications require the use of disablenumlock. DOS applications are not affected.
